Is solar actually cheaper than coal?

When it comes to the cost of energy from new power plants, onshore wind and solar are now the cheapest sources—costing less than gas, geothermal, coal, or nuclear. Utility-scale solar arrays are now the least costly option to build and operate.

What is the cheapest way to produce electricity?

The consensus of recent major global studies of generation costs is that wind and solar power are the lowest-cost sources of electricity available today.

Can solar energy replace coal?

Wind and solar energy are helping to replace coal power generation, but with demand for electricity … Wind and solar energy generation doubled from 2015 to 2020 and now make up about one tenth of global electricity generation.

What is the cheapest renewable energy source?

Renewables are the Cheapest Sources of New Electricity

Energy Source Type 2020 Cost ($/MWh)
Solar Photovoltaic Renewable $37
Onshore Wind Renewable $40
Gas – Peaker Plants Non-renewable $175
Gas – Combined Cycle Plants Non-renewable $59
